Seward Park

One afternoon, Alec, Clem, Joani and I took a walk in Seward Park which is just down the way from their house.  Neither of us had ever been and I was kicking myself because Molly would have loved it. We started out together but the light rain and quiet ambient light made for a sort of peaceful melancholy mood, and without even deciding to, we were all walking separately, each enjoying the walk in our own way.  

I wore a hooded rain jacket and watched as drops occasionally dripped from the front.  Beyond the rain pattering on my jacket, it was very quiet.  It was so peaceful in a way that is rare these days (as anyone with a baby could understand).
